Maserati at the conquest of India

Maserati has just announced its debut on the Indian market. It will do so with a first showroom in the city of Mumbai, which is due to open this year. Will follow in early 2012, a second shop in New Delhi and then we will see further expansion of the network in five major Indian cities planned by 2015.

The Indian office will combine the experience of Maserati Trident in terms of services, support and network management with expertise in the Indian market Shreyans group that has earned a place in the years leading in many areas of the luxury market in India , ranging from engines to fashion.

With the resumption of the Indian economy, the auto market in the country east of sales recorded 1.87 million in 2010 to an annual growth of 25%. An impressive growth rate, but that is nothing compared to what the field of luxury cars, which last year recorded an increase of 70%. Maserati provides a mix of sales accounting for 80% of the Quattroporte and the remaining 20% of the GranTurismo and GranTurismo.

It is expected that customers should be those most enthusiastic in Mumbai and New Delhi: the latter, in particular, will absorb 40% of the entire distribution of Maserati and Mumbai in India 35%.
